Transaction 58458b8207b0be25a40bb84a7dd39990fb41c949b1874655105961e69dc7618c
1 Input
1 Output
-
58458b8207b0be25a40bb84a7dd39990fb41c949b1874655105961e69dc7618c:0
- value
- 763463
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3506b3cf9eea517294ecda7edec76fb28eefff95 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15qNqrhz44aPjcmbyQS3e2MX7Y218wwGbs